H'el`ene Darroze New Chef at The Connaught

. October 14, 2008

LONDON, UK, March 26, 2008. The Connaught has announced Michelin-starred French Chef H'el`ene Darroze, as the Chef at the helm of the landmark hotel in Mayfair, as it completes its nine month lb70 million restoration and renovation programme.

One of France's most distinguished chefs, she currently holds two Michelin stars at her restaurant 'H'el`ene Darroze' on the Left Bank in Paris. At The Connaught in June 2008 she will initially launch a signature restaurant to be known as 'H'el`ene Darroze at The Connaught' it will be designed by Parisian based India Mahdavi. In addition to this restaurant, H'el`ene will also oversee all culinary aspects of the hotel including The Gallery, an informal , elegant dining venue overlooking Carlos Place, and private and in-room dining. She will also be responsible for the revival of the famed Connaught Grill which will be returning in the Autumn.

H'el`ene will split her time between her two restaurants, initially focussing heavily on the London operation, taking a flat in Mayfair and integrating into The Connaught way of life. She will be bringing a dedicated team of experienced staff from her Paris kitchen to lead a brigade of local talent.

H'el`ene Darroze hails from a long line of chefs. Her great grandfather was a patissier, and her great grandmother was a cook. She works with exceptional ingredients to create a cuisine which expresses the authentic flavours of her native Landes in South West France, and a savoir faire learnt from her culinary family since early childhood. This has remained the foundation of her cooking philosophy and she continues to be inspired by her roots with her menus offering regional and seasonal delicacies. "Each season offers something that enchants and inspires me." she says.

H'el`ene had a very prestigious start into the culinary arena when, in 1990 she worked as the right hand woman for Alain Ducasse when he had just gained his third star for the Louis XV restaurant in Monte Carlo. She then went on to run her family's Villeneuve-de-Marsan restaurant before opening her own establishment 'H'el`ene Darroze' in Paris in 1999. In 2001 she won her first Michelin star achieving her second star in 2003.

The Connaught has recently invested in a lb70 million restoration and renovation programme which includes a magnificent redesign of the guest rooms, suites and interiors and has brought together some of the world's finest designers and craftsmen. The legendary hotel has been brought into the 21st century while preserving with great care its authentic elegance, distinct personality and intuitive style of service.
